Take metro line M1 or M2 to the "Avenue Louise" station, then walk 600 meters to reach the Auditorium. The journey takes only 15 minutes with frequent departures. Alternatively, bus lines 28 or 43 stop at "Rue de la Loi," just a 7-minute walk away. The metro exit features multilingual signage and accessible ramps, ensuring ease of access for all travelers. Use the Brussels Mobility card for discounted fares across public transit options.

Book at least 4 weeks ahead, especially for major symphony concerts or international artist appearances. The Auditorium’s official website features a real-time ticketing system with multilingual support and secure payment options. Early bird offers provide up to 20% off, while student discounts and group packages are also available. Tickets are delivered digitally via email or app with transport guides and entry instructions. Assistance is available through the official customer hotline for seamless planning.
